The RSI 2TF Indicator is a popular and free Forex Indicator for the MetaTrader 4 (MT4) platform. This momentum-based indicator measures the speed and change of price movements and is designed to identify short-term overbought and oversold conditions. By combining Relative Strength Index (RSI) readings from two different timeframes, the RSI 2TF Indicator provides traders with a more accurate picture of potential reversal points in the market.

Short-term market reversals can be difficult to identify, but the RSI 2TF Indicator makes it easier. The indicator uses two RSIs applied to separate timeframes: one on a shorter timeframe and another on a longer timeframe. These are then combined to give a single signal that highlights areas where the market may be overbought or oversold, allowing traders to anticipate potential turning points.

How the RSI 2TF Indicator Works

The RSI 2TF Indicator consists of two key components:

Short-Term RSI: Applied to a smaller timeframe, this RSI measures rapid price movements and detects immediate market momentum.

Long-Term RSI: Applied to a larger timeframe, this RSI smooths out fluctuations and provides a broader market perspective.

When the combined indicator indicates overbought conditions, it suggests that the market may be due for a downward reversal. Conversely, when the indicator shows oversold conditions, it signals a potential upward reversal. Traders can use these signals to identify entry and exit points more accurately, improving their trading performance.

How to Use the RSI 2TF Indicator

Download and install the indicator in the MT4 Indicators folder

Restart MetaTrader 4

Attach the RSI 2TF Indicator to your preferred chart

Observe overbought and oversold signals to identify potential reversals

Combine with other trend or support/resistance indicators for confirmation

Best Practices

Use the indicator alongside higher timeframe analysis for trend confirmation

Avoid trading solely based on overbought/oversold signals during low volatility periods

Apply proper risk management and position sizing

Combine with other technical tools to improve accuracy
